Meet and greets – I would absolutely love to do a meet and greet. If I’m coming to you (drop-ins/walks/house sitting) I want to meet you and the animal, find out where any supplies needed are located and get information/directions from you. If you’re coming to me (daycare/boarding) I want to meet you and your pet and allow you to see where your pet will be staying. As far as introducing the dogs – meet and greets don’t really give a good idea on how they will interact together. Your pet has had a car ride, new place and person (me), and a ton of new smells. My dogs will be excited for the visitors (you). With all that excitement in a short amount of time, it can be a bit much to put the dogs together and not a true reflection. However, you’re welcome to meet them so you can see their personalities. I have a slow introduction process that happens after everyone has calmed down. If your pet is being dropped off the first day during my working hours, they stay with me in my office/sunroom. My dogs will be in the rest of the house and everyone can see each other through glass sliders. Once everyone seems bored of each other, I’ll start introducing. Sometimes we’ll all go on a walk together. Sometimes I’ll take everyone outside and have some dogs on the deck with a gate (they can smell each other). Sometimes I introduce my Yorkie first, then my lab and vice versa. Personalities will decide introduction time/method. If boarding – if time allows, a trial day of daycare is a great test. My house is set up in a way that if the dogs can’t co-mingle everyone can have their own space.
